Discovering the Enchantment of "Asleep In The Woods" by Jules Breton

Unveiling the Artistic Vision: Jules Breton's Mastery

The Life and Influence of Jules Breton

Jules Breton, born in 1827 in the picturesque town of CourriÉres, France, became a prominent figure in the art world. His upbringing in a rural environment deeply influenced his artistic vision. Breton's dedication to capturing the essence of peasant life and nature set him apart from his contemporaries. He was not only a painter but also a poet, which enriched his ability to convey emotion through his art. His works often reflect a deep appreciation for the simplicity and beauty of rural existence.

Breton's Signature Style: Realism and Romanticism

Breton's style is a harmonious blend of realism and romanticism. He skillfully depicted the everyday lives of ordinary people, infusing his paintings with a sense of nostalgia and warmth. His attention to detail and vibrant colors brought his subjects to life. In "Asleep In The Woods," Breton captures a serene moment, showcasing his ability to evoke emotion through natural settings and human figures.

Historical Context: The Era of Breton's Creation

Art Movements Influencing Breton: From Barbizon to Impressionism

Breton's work was influenced by the Barbizon School, which emphasized realism and the beauty of nature. This movement laid the groundwork for impressionism, which Breton also embraced. His ability to blend these styles allowed him to create works that resonate with both traditional and modern audiences.
